Within Azure AD, they are represented by service principals and are free in all plans. The only place where you might need to spend additional $$$ on them is if you need any of the Workload identities SKU features: https://learn.microsoft.com/en-us/azure/active-directory/workload-identities/workload-identities-overview Integration with other services outside of Azure AD might not be free however.

Azure Active Directory (P1 or P2) pricing is on a per user basis (Ref: https://azure.microsoft.com/en-us/pricing/details/active-directory/)
Wanted to understand that when we use Managed Identity and Azure AD App Registrations in our implementation; are there are any costs on a per Managed Identity / Azure AD App Registration provisioned in Azure Active Directory (P2 Plan)? Are they free in Azure Active Directory P2 Plan OR are they charged as if each managed identity and each app registration is a user?
